4,295,010,762 is a composite number, even.
4,295,010,762 (four billion two hundred ninety-five million ten thousand seven hundred sixty-two) is an even 10-digit number. It is a composite number with 96 divisors, and factors as 2 × 3² × 7 × 19 × 139 × 12,907. Its proper divisors sum to 6,981,418,038,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x10000A9CA.
